Understanding Hives:

Hives, also referred to as urticaria, manifest as raised, itchy welts on the skin, often with defined borders and a pale center. They can vary in size and shape and may appear suddenly, disappearing just as quickly. The underlying cause of hives lies in the body's immunological response to certain triggers. Let's explore these triggers and the signs and symptoms associated with hives.

Common Triggers of Hives:

1.Allergic Reactions: One of the primary triggers of hives is exposure to allergens. These allergens can include certain foods, medications, insect stings, or environmental factors. When the body's immune system perceives these substances as threats, it releases histamines, leading to the characteristic welts and itching.

2.Contact Dermatitis: Skin contact with certain substances, such as chemicals, plants, or metals, can cause contact dermatitis. leading to the development of hives. Identifying and avoiding these irritants is crucial in preventing recurrent episodes.

3.Stress-Induced Hives: Emotional stress can play a significant role in the development of hives. Stress triggers the release of stress hormones, which, in turn, can activate the immune system and lead to the formation of welts on the skin.

Exploring Immunological Responses:

Hives are intricately connected to the body's immune system. Understanding the immunological responses that lead to their development is key to managing and preventing their occurrence. When the immune system detects a perceived threat, it releases histamines, compounds that cause blood vessels to leak fluid. This leakage results in the characteristic swelling and welts associated with hives.

The Role of Allergens in Hives:

Allergens, substances that trigger allergic reactions, play a pivotal role in the development of hives. Common allergens include certain foods like nuts, shellfish, and eggs, as well as medications such as antibiotics and non-steroidal anti-inflammatory drugs (NSAIDs). Environmental factors like pollen, animal dander, and insect stings can also contribute to the onset of hives.

It's essential to recognize the signs of an allergic reaction leading to hives. Individuals may experience itching, redness, and swelling, which can progress to the development of wheals and a widespread rash. In severe cases, allergic reactions can lead to anaphylaxis, a life-threatening condition requiring immediate medical attention.

Autoimmune Conditions and Hives:

While allergens are common triggers, hives can also be associated with autoimmune conditions. Autoimmune urticaria occurs when the immune system mistakenly targets healthy cells in the body, leading to the release of histamines and the development of hives. Conditions such as lupus and rheumatoid arthritis have been linked to autoimmune urticaria, highlighting the diverse factors that contribute to the onset of hives.

Understanding the autoimmune component of hives is crucial for appropriate diagnosis and management. Healthcare professionals may conduct autoimmune tests to identify underlying conditions, allowing for targeted treatment and preventive measures.

Chronic Hives and the Importance of Medical Evaluation:

While hives often resolve on their own or with appropriate treatment, some individuals may experience chronic hives, defined as hives lasting for six weeks or more. Chronic hives can significantly impact one's quality of life, leading to ongoing discomfort and psychological distress.

In cases of chronic hives, a thorough medical evaluation is essential to identify the underlying cause. Healthcare professionals may conduct tests to assess immune system function, allergy triggers, and autoimmune conditions. This comprehensive approach enables the development of a tailored treatment plan to address the specific factors contributing to chronic hives.

Treatment Options for Hives:

Effective management of hives involves a combination of symptomatic relief and addressing the underlying triggers. Treatment options may include:

1.Antihistamines: These medications, available over the counter or by prescription, can help alleviate itching and reduce the severity of hives by blocking the action of histamines.

2.Corticosteroids: In cases of severe hives, healthcare professionals may prescribe corticosteroids to reduce inflammation and suppress the immune response.

3.Epinephrine (Adrenaline): In instances of anaphylaxis or severe allergic reactions leading to hives, epinephrine may be administered to rapidly reverse symptoms. Individuals at risk of anaphylaxis may carry an epinephrine auto-injector for immediate use.

4.Identifying and Avoiding Triggers: Understanding specific triggers, whether allergens, stress, or environmental factors, is crucial in preventing recurrent episodes of hives. Allergy testing, consultation with healthcare professionals, and lifestyle modifications can aid in trigger identification.

What is the UV Index?

The UV index is a scale that measures the strength of ultraviolet (UV) radiation from the sun. UV rays are invisible rays that come from the sun and can damage our skin, eyes, and even our immune system. The higher the UV index, the stronger the UV rays—and the greater the risk of skin damage.

The index ranges from 0 to 11+:

UV Index

Risk Level

Sun Protection Advice

0-2

Low

Minimal risk. Safe to be outside.

3-5

Moderate

Use sunscreen and wear sunglasses.

6-7

High

Stay in shade, wear protective clothing.

8-10

Very High

Avoid going out in peak sun hours.

11+

Extreme

Stay indoors if possible. Use full protection.

 

Why UV Rays Are Harmful

There are two main types of UV rays that reach the earth:

  1. UVA Rays: These rays can cause skin aging and wrinkles.
     

  2. UVB Rays: These rays can lead to sunburn and skin cancer.
     

Both UVA and UVB rays can damage skin cells. Over time, repeated exposure increases the risk of:

  • Skin cancer, including melanoma (the most dangerous type)
     

  • Sunburn
     

  • Dark spots and uneven skin tone
     

  • Premature aging (wrinkles, fine lines)
     

  • Eye problems like cataracts

Best Times to Avoid the Sun

UV rays are strongest between 10 a.m. and 4 p.m. During this time, even on cloudy days, your skin can get damaged. Plan your outdoor activities either in the early morning or late afternoon when the sun is not too harsh.

 

Tips for Skin Protection

Here’s how you can protect your skin based on the UV index and your daily routine:

1. Wear Sunscreen Daily

Use a broad-spectrum sunscreen with SPF 30 or higher. Apply it 15–30 minutes before going out. Reapply every 2 hours, or immediately after swimming or sweating.

Quick tip: Don’t skip sunscreen on cloudy days—the UV rays still reach your skin.

2. Wear Protective Clothing

  • Long-sleeved shirts
     

  • Wide-brimmed hats
     

  • Sunglasses with UV protection
     

  • Light-colored, tightly woven clothes that cover more skin
     

3. Stay in the Shade

When the UV index is high, look for shaded areas like under trees, umbrellas, or buildings. If you’re at the beach or park, carry your own shade (like a sun umbrella).

4. Use UV-Blocking Accessories

Use UV-protective umbrellas, scarves, or even UV-filtering window films if you spend long hours indoors near windows.

5. Stay Hydrated

Exposure to sun can dehydrate your skin. Drink plenty of water and use a moisturizer with SPF to keep your skin healthy.

Common Myths About UV and Sun Protection

Myth 1: I only need sunscreen in summer.
Truth: UV rays are present all year—even in winter.

Myth 2: Dark skin doesn’t get sunburned.
Truth: While melanin offers some protection, dark skin can still get sunburned and is also at risk of skin cancer.

Myth 3: I’m safe if I sit behind a window.
Truth: UVA rays can pass through glass. You can still get sun damage indoors near windows.

 

How Often Should You Apply Sunscreen?

Most people don’t apply enough sunscreen or forget to reapply. Here’s a guide:

  • Use at least a shot glass full of sunscreen for the body and a nickel-sized amount for the face.
     

  • Reapply every 2 hours if you're outdoors.
     

  • Reapply after swimming, sweating, or towel drying.
